Background of the High-Profile Case
The investigation began after Sushant Singh Rajput was found dead in his Mumbai apartment on June 14, 2020. What initially appeared to be a straightforward case quickly evolved into a media circus with multiple angles, including:
- Financial misconduct allegations against Chakraborty
- Drug-related accusations that led to separate investigations
- Intense media scrutiny and public speculation
- Multiple agency involvement including CBI, ED, and NCB
Chakraborty's Legal Journey
Rhea Chakraborty faced numerous legal challenges throughout the investigation, including arrest and time in judicial custody related to drug charges. The recent CBI clearance on financial matters represents a major victory for the actress and her legal team, though other aspects of the case continue to be examined.
